Jacksonville is a small community in Ohio with about 346 residents. It grades A+ for safety & wellbeing and C for lifestyle & connectivity. Standout strengths include property crime, violent crime, and air quality. It rates lower on sunny days and broadband access.
- The median home value in Jacksonville is $74k, per the U.S. Census ACS (5-Year).
- Median household income in Jacksonville is $47k, per the U.S. Census ACS (5-Year).
- Jacksonville has a violent crime rate of 0/100k, per the FBI Uniform Crime Reports.
- July temperatures in Jacksonville average around 75°F, per the NOAA nClimGrid.
